1. Sudden Sensorineural Hearing Loss (SSNHL): A True Medical Emergency
Sudden Sensorineural Hearing Loss (SSNHL) is one of the most time-sensitive conditions in ENT medicine. It refers to a rapid, unexpected drop in hearing usually in just one ear that develops in 72 hours or less. It occurs when the inner ear or auditory nerve suddenly stops functioning correctly. SSNHL is not caused by wax, and there is no benefit in waiting to see if it improves on its own.How Ssnhl Feels
Patients typically report:- “Woke up and everything sounded muffled”
- “It feels like my ear is blocked, but it won’t clear”
- “I suddenly can’t hear the phone on that side”
- “There’s ringing with the drop in hearing”
- Tinnitus
- Vertigo
- Ear pressure/fullness without pain
- Distorted sound perception
Why SSNHL Is An Emergency
The only proven treatment for SSNHL is urgent steroids, ideally prescribed within a few hours of symptom onset. Clinical evidence consistently proves that:- The earlier treatment starts, the greater the chance of hearing recovery
- Delays may result in permanent nerve damage
2. Sudden Deterioration Of An Existing Hearing Problem
In contrast, the more common cause of sudden hearing changes is not nerve damage but a middle-ear or mechanical problem. This is especially seen in people who already have age-related hearing decline, noise-induced loss or a pre-existing hearing issue, and suddenly experience a drop.Common reasons include:
- Middle ear effusion (fluid behind the eardrum)
- Eustachian tube dysfunction
- Acute ear infections
- Impacted earwax
Understanding Fluid Behind The Eardrum — Otitis Media With Effusion
Middle ear effusion, fluid trapped behind the eardrum, is one of the most common non-emergency causes of sudden hearing reduction. Patients often describe:- Hearing that sounds “underwater”
- Pressure or fullness
- Hearing that fluctuates with head position
- No pain

Comparison Table: Sudden Hearing Loss Vs Blocked-Ear Conditions
| Condition | Cause | Onset | Key Symptoms | Urgency | Treatment |
| SSNHL | Inner-ear / nerve damage | Sudden (≤ 72 hrs) | Sudden drop, tinnitus, vertigo | Emergency | Urgent steroids from ENT |
| Middle Ear Effusion | Fluid behind eardrum | Gradual or sudden | Underwater sound, pressure | Assessment required | Medication ± observation |
| Acute Ear Infection | Bacterial/viral | Sudden | Pain, fever, muffled hearing | Medical review | Pain relief ± antibiotics |
| Impacted Earwax | Wax blockage | Gradual or sudden | Blocked hearing, crackling, itch | Routine | Microsuction / wax removal |
| Eustachian Tube Dysfunction | Pressure regulation issue | Gradual / variable | Popping, echo, discomfort | Non-urgent | Nasal sprays, auto-inflation |
3. How Clinicians Quickly Tell The Difference
When patients tell us, “My ear feels blocked,” we never assume it’s wax. We follow a systematic diagnostic pathway:Otoscopy
A detailed visual inspection of the eardrum and canal to determine whether there is:- Wax blockage
- Middle-ear fluid
- Infection
- Anatomical changes
- Perforation
Tuning Fork Tests (Rinne & Weber)
These quick bedside tests reveal whether the hearing problem is:- Conductive (wax / fluid / infection) or
- Sensorineural (inner-ear / nerve)
4. Why Immediate Assessment Protects Long-Term Hearing
Waiting to see whether hearing returns is the most dangerous approach when SSNHL is present. The “blocked” feeling of SSNHL is deceptive, it can feel identical to wax or fluid, but the consequences of delay are completely different. A simple assessment may lead to:- Immediate relief with wax removal or
- Emergency ENT referral for hearing-saving steroids
Can Sudden Hearing Loss Be Caused By Earwax?
Yes, impacted wax can cause sudden hearing reduction. However, SSNHL can feel identical to patients, and delaying treatment can risk permanent hearing loss.How Do I Know If My Ear Is Blocked By Wax Or Something More Serious?
Wax often causes gradual or intermittent hearing loss, itchiness or crackling. SSNHL is sudden and may include tinnitus or vertigo. The only safe way to tell the difference is professional testing.Should I Go To A&E For Sudden Hearing Loss?
Yes. If hearing drops suddenly without a clear explanation, A&E or urgent ENT care is recommended because SSNHL requires fast steroid treatment.
